| #ifndef _include_amtl_fixedarray_h_
 | |
| #define _include_amtl_fixedarray_h_
 | |
| 
 | |
| #include <am-utility.h>
 | |
| #include <am-allocator-policies.h>
 | |
| #include <am-moveable.h>
 | |
| 
 | |
| namespace ke {
 | |
| 
 | |
| template <typename T, typename AllocPolicy = SystemAllocatorPolicy>
 | |
| class FixedArray : public AllocPolicy
 | |
| {
 | |
|  public:
 | |
|   FixedArray(size_t length, AllocPolicy = AllocPolicy()) {
 | |
|     length_ = length;
 | |
|     data_ = (T *)this->malloc(sizeof(T) * length_);
 | |
|     if (!data_)
 | |
|       return;
 | |
| 
 | |
|     for (size_t i = 0; i < length_; i++)
 | |
|       new (&data_[i]) T();
 | |
|   }
 | |
|   ~FixedArray() {
 | |
|     for (size_t i = 0; i < length_; i++)
 | |
|       data_[i].~T();
 | |
|     this->free(data_);
 | |
|   }
 | |
| 
 | |
|   // This call may be skipped if the allocator policy is infallible.
 | |
|   bool initialize() {
 | |
|     return length_ == 0 || !!data_;
 | |
|   }
 | |
| 
 | |
|   size_t length() const {
 | |
|     return length_;
 | |
|   }
 | |
|   T &operator [](size_t index) {
 | |
|     return at(index);
 | |
|   }
 | |
|   const T &operator [](size_t index) const {
 | |
|     return at(index);
 | |
|   }
 | |
|   T &at(size_t index) {
 | |
|     assert(index < length());
 | |
|     return data_[index];
 | |
|   }
 | |
|   const T &at(size_t index) const {
 | |
|     assert(index < length());
 | |
|     return data_[index];
 | |
|   }
 | |
|   void set(size_t index, const T &t) {
 | |
|     assert(index < length());
 | |
|     data_[index] = t;
 | |
|   }
 | |
|   void set(size_t index, ke::Moveable<T> t) {
 | |
|     assert(index < length());
 | |
|     data_[index] = t;
 | |
|   }
 | |
| 
 | |
|  private:
 | |
|   FixedArray(const FixedArray &other) KE_DELETE;
 | |
|   FixedArray &operator =(const FixedArray &other) KE_DELETE;
 | |
| 
 | |
|  private:
 | |
|   size_t length_;
 | |
|   T *data_;
 | |
| };
 | |
| 
 | |
| } // namespace ke
 | |
| 
 | |
| #endif // _include_amtl_fixedarray_h_
